I find it hard to believe that the 1LE ran that quick compared to these cars.
Far more importantly, the official time for the Camaro 1LE is 4.46 seconds quicker around VIR than the 2012 Ford Mustang Boss 302 Laguna Seca – the $49k muscle car at which GM has taken aim with the new Camaro 1LE. The 2013 Chevrolet Camaro 1LE’s time around VIR of 2:58.34 is also better than the 2010 Ford Shelby GT500 (2:58.48), the 2009 Audi R8 V10 (2:59.50) and the 2011 Cadillac CTS-V Coupe (3:04.20). In the list of 22 vehicles that turned in quicker laps than the 2013 Camaro 1LE are some incredible sports cars including the 2013 Ford Shelby GT500 (2:58.00), the Ferrari 430 Scuderia (2:54.60), the Lamborghini Murcielago LP 670-4 SuperVeloce (2:53.90), the 2008 Dodge Viper SRT10 ACR (2:48.60) and the Chevrolet Corvette ZR1 – which turned in a track record time of 2:45.63. |
